Abstract:
Based on the existing data of selfrecorded and automatic precipitation in Guizhou, the temporal and spatial distribution characteristics of the annual maximum rainfall intensity, the maximum rainfall intensity during 1954-2017 in national meteorological stations in Guizhou, and the variation trends of rain intensity from 1968 to 2017 are statistically analyzed. The results show that the annual rain intensity in Guizhou was between 13.6 mm to 117.4 mm per hour, and the maximum of the years in Guizhou was between 53.0 mm to 117.4 mm per hour. The hourly maximum rainfall intensity in the southwest, midwest, northeast, and southeast areas were all over 100 mm per hour. The southwest had the strongest rainfall intensity. The heavy rainfall in Guizhou occurred from March to November, mainly between May and August, while the heaviest rainfall happened in June. The heavy rainfall in Guizhou was characterized by obvious night occurrence, usually around 02:00 at midnight, more in the first half of the night than in the second half. The occurrence frequency at noontime was the least. The increase/decrease trend of rain intensity in Guizhou was not obvious, with the slight increases in southeast, south and west, and the slight decreases in northeast and northwest.
